

Phi Beta Sigma is one of the oldest historically Black fraternities in the country, founded at Howard University in 1914. The fraternity now serves more than 200,000 lifetime members across nearly 600 chapters worldwide.
This fraternity website redesign had to solve a straightforward but common problem: too much unused white space, not enough visual weight to hold visitor attention, slow load times, and broken links in the main navigation.
Built on WordPress and Elementor with a cleaner, more modern layout built around brand colors and photography, the rebuild included a new wireframe for more intuitive navigation and updated infographics matched to the new visual system. The site links out to “The BluPrint,” the fraternity’s proprietary chapter management portal.
The fraternity’s WordPress and Elementor site loads faster, navigates more intuitively, and gives the organization a visual presence that matches its scale and history.
